Side-by-side financial comparison of Blackstone Inc. (BX) and T. Rowe Price (TROW), based on the latest 10-Q / 10-K filings.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Blackstone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($4.4B vs $1.9B, roughly 2.3× T. Rowe Price). Blackstone Inc. runs the higher net margin — 23.3% vs 23.0%, a 0.3%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Blackstone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(41.4% vs 6.0%). Blackstone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($1.0B vs $-85.4M). Over the past eight quarters, Blackstone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(8.7% CAGR vs 5.1%).

Blackstone Inc. is an American alternative investment management company based in New York City. It was founded in 1985 as a mergers and acquisitions firm by Peter Peterson and Stephen Schwarzman, who had previously worked together at Lehman Brothers. Blackstone's private equity business has been one of the largest investors in leveraged buyouts in the last three decades, while its real estate business has actively acquired commercial real estate across the globe.

T. Rowe Price Group, Inc. is an American publicly owned global investment management firm that offers funds, subadvisory services, separate account management, and retirement plans and services for individuals, institutions, and financial intermediaries. The firm has assets under management of more than $1.51 trillion and annual revenues of $6.48 billion as of 2023, placing it 537 on the Fortune 1000 list of the largest U.S. companies.
